It takes most of the countries in the world and turns them into humans, with the history and stereotypes of that country. It's mostly set during WW2 (the shows, anyway), so the main characters are the Axis Powers (Italy, Germany, and Japan) and the Allied Powers (America, Britain/England, France, China, and Russia).
